Wybron is fairly good to work with if you contact them directly. I've done a lot of debugging of the Infogate for them in the past. If you need any help getting in touch with them let me know.
You can of course send your product to them with a check for $250 and they'll test the compliance of it to the standard and get it "IFE Certified"

This is why I'm a strong supporter of what we are doing with the ESTA RDM Plugfests and a critic of the "IFE" effort as compliance really only means it works with their product and not correctly to the standard. It's like a Microsoft standard in that regard.
